Dark Chocolate M&M Cookies
Satisfy your chocolate cravings with Dark Chocolate M&M Cookies. These decadent treats are loaded with rich chocolatey goodness and topped with festive M&Ms.
Equipment
- parchment paper
- sheet pans
Ingredients
- 1/2 cup unsalted butter room temperature
- 1/2 cup granulated sugar
- 1/2 cup dark brown sugar packed
- 1 large egg preferably room temperature
- 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
- 1 cup all-purpose flour
- 1/2 cup + 2 Tbsp. Hershey’s Special Dark Cocoa Powder
- 1 teaspoon baking soda
- 1/4 teaspoon salt
- 1 Tbsp. milk
- 1 1/4 cups semi sweet chocolate chips
- Dark Chocolate M&M’s for topping the cookies
Instructions
- Line 2 baking sheets with parchment paper or silicone baking mats.
- In the bowl of an electric mixer, combine the butter and sugars. Beat together on medium-high speed until light and fluffy, 2-3 minutes. Blend in the egg and vanilla, scrape down the bowl if needed.
- In a separate bowl, whisk together the flour, cocoa powder, baking soda, and salt. Slowly add the dry ingredients into the wet ingredients in the mixer on low speed just until incorporated. Mix in the milk on the lowest speed and fold in the chocolate chips. .
- Preheat the oven to 350˚ F
- Roll 2 tablespoons of dough into balls and place on the baking sheets. Top cookies with M&M’s. Place cookie sheet in freezer for 10-15 minutes.
- Bake 10-11 minutes. Let cool on the baking sheets for about 5 minutes, then transfer to a wire rack to cool completely.
Notes
I used half dark chocolate cocoa powder and half regular, only due to running out of the dark. This recipe makes large cookies, so if you are making them smaller, take into account the bake time will be a little shorter.
